Building on the success of the PCM96, the new PCM96 Surround offers more
presets, more configuration options, and more inputs and outputs. The PCM96 Sur-
round gives you industry standard reverbs and effects, with tremendous flexibility.
Use the PCM96 Surround as a plug-in with your DAW, or keep it connected to your
mixer. Either way, you have a multitude of configuration options to choose from,
without having to move any cables.
The PCM96 Surround is available with either 6 channels of XLR/AES inputs and
outputs, or 2 DB25 6-channel analog I/O and 1 DB25 6-channel digital I/O. Both
versions also feature MIDI, Wordclock, Ethernet, and FireWire®.

ROUTING OPTIONS
The PCM96 Surround can be
divided in up to four virtual
machines, each of which can
run its own algorithm. This
allows the signal from each
input to be routed through
a variety of algorithm
combinations.
